Sestrin2 facilitates glutamine-dependent transcription of PGC-1α and survival of liver cancer cells under glucose limitation.

Abstract

Differential utilization of metabolites and metabolic plasticity can confer adaptation to cancer cells under metabolic stress. Glutamine is one of the vital and versatile nutrients that cancer cells consume avidly for their proliferation, and therefore mechanisms related to glutamine metabolism have been identified as targets. Recently, sestrin2 (SESN2), a stress-inducible protein, has been reported to regulate survival in glutamine-depleted cancer cells; based on this, we explored if SESN2 could regulate glutamine metabolism during glucose starvation. This report highlights the role of SESN2 in the regulation of glutamine-dependent activation of the mitochondrial biogenesis marker pe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or γ coactivator 1α (PGC-1α) under glucose scarcity in liver cancer cells (HepG2). We demonstrate that down-regulation of SESN2 induces a decrease in the levels of intracellular glutamine and PGC-1α under glucose deprivation, concomitant with a decline in cell survival, but no effect was observed on the invasive or migration potential of the cells. Under similar metabolic conditions, SESN2 forms a complex with c-Jun N-terminal kinase (JNK) and forkhead box protein O1 (FOXO1). Absence of SESN2 or inhibition of JNK reduces nuclear translocation of FOXO1, consequently causing transcriptional inhibition of PGC-1α. Notably, our observations demonstrate a reduction in cell viability under high glutamine and low glucose conditions during SESN2 down-regulation that could be rescued on JNK inhibition. To recover from acetaminophen-induced mitochondrial damage, SESN2 was crucial for glutamine-mediated activation of PGC-1α in HepG2 cells. Collectively, we demonstrate a novel role of SESN2 in mediating activation of PGC-1α by modulating glutamine metabolism that facilitates cancer cell survival under glucose-limited metabolic conditions.

摘要

代谢物的差异利用和代谢可塑性可以使癌细胞在代谢应激下适应。谷氨酰胺是一种重要且多功能的营养物质,癌细胞会强烈地消耗它来进行增殖,因此与谷氨酰胺代谢相关的机制已被确定为靶点。最近,应激诱导蛋白 sestrin2(SESN2)被报道可调节谷氨酰胺耗尽的癌细胞的存活;基于此,我们探讨了 SESN2 是否可以在葡萄糖饥饿期间调节谷氨酰胺代谢。本报告强调了 SESN2 在调节葡萄糖缺乏时肝癌细胞(HepG2)中线粒体生物发生标志物过氧化物酶体增殖物激活受体 γ 共激活因子 1α(PGC-1α)的谷氨酰胺依赖性激活中的作用。我们证明 SESN2 的下调会在葡萄糖剥夺下降低细胞内谷氨酰胺和 PGC-1α 的水平,同时伴随着细胞存活能力下降,但对细胞的侵袭或迁移能力没有影响。在类似的代谢条件下,SESN2 与 c-Jun N 末端激酶(JNK)和叉头框蛋白 O1(FOXO1)形成复合物。SESN2 缺失或 JNK 抑制会减少 FOXO1 的核转位,从而导致 PGC-1α 的转录抑制。值得注意的是,我们的观察表明,在 SESN2 下调下,高谷氨酰胺和低葡萄糖条件下的细胞活力降低,而 JNK 抑制可挽救这种情况。为了从对乙酰氨基酚引起的线粒体损伤中恢复过来,SESN2 对于 HepG2 细胞中谷氨酰胺介导的 PGC-1α 激活至关重要。总之,我们证明了 SESN2 在调节谷氨酰胺代谢方面发挥了新的作用,通过调节谷氨酰胺代谢促进了癌细胞在葡萄糖限制的代谢条件下的存活。
